‘What a mess and blessing,’ says pastor of clean-up

We Care 4 Nelspruit recently took to cleaning up the Ehmke/Ferreira Street green belt, and what a task it was.

Pr TJ Maré said the day was challenging and that he would rather not say what kinds of rubbish they found in the area.

“Wow, what a day! We cleaned the most northern point of the Ehmke/Ferreira green belt – what a mess and blessing.”

Maré thanked the City of Mbombela for collecting the waste.

Dr Attie van Wyk also received a thank you for the Wimpy lunch he had provided.

“We know you and your team care deeply about out city,” said Van Wyk. “It was so beautiful to look at the babbling stream without all the waste.”

Maré said it was a privilege and that there was more to come for the area.

This is in the pipeline
• 2x CCTV cameras (monitored 24/7)
• More effective streetlights
• Maintenance.

“We need all the help we can get.”
